How to fill out corporate governance charter

Illustration

How to fill out corporate governance charter

01
Title the document as 'Corporate Governance Charter'.
02
Begin with an introduction that outlines the purpose of the charter.
03
Define the scope of the charter, specifying the governance structure of the organization.
04
List the roles and responsibilities of the board of directors and committees.
05
Outline the procedures for board meetings, including frequency and quorum requirements.
06
Include policies regarding conflict of interest, ethical conduct, and compliance.
07
Define the process for evaluating board performance and adopting the charter.
08
Specify the methods of communication among board members and stakeholders.
09
Conclude with provisions for amendments to the charter.

Who needs corporate governance charter?

01
Publicly traded companies that are required by law to have a governance framework.
02
Private companies seeking to formalize their governance practices.
03
Non-profit organizations aiming for transparency and ethical management.
04
Organizations undergoing a merger or acquisition to align governance structures.

Comprehensive Guide to Corporate Governance Charter Form

Understanding corporate governance charters

A corporate governance charter serves as a foundational document that outlines the structure and function of an organization's governance framework. This essential document not only delineates the roles and responsibilities of board members and committees but also sets forth policies that guide ethical decision-making and compliance. Corporate governance is vital for ensuring transparency, accountability, and adherence to regulations, thereby safeguarding stakeholder interests and enhancing organizational reputation.

The importance of a corporate governance charter cannot be overstated; it provides a roadmap for how an organization conducts its affairs, defines the decision-making process, and helps manage risks. By adhering to best practices in governance, organizations can attract investors, enhance operational efficiency, and foster a culture of integrity.

Defines the roles and responsibilities of board members and committees.
Enhances accountability and compliance with regulations.
Sets the standards for ethical behavior and decision-making.
Strengthens stakeholder trust and organizational reputation.

Identifying the essential elements of a corporate governance charter

Crafting a robust corporate governance charter involves identifying key components that will guide the organization in its governance practices. This includes determining the structure and composition of the board of directors, which plays a critical role in the governance ecosystem. The board's responsibilities encompass strategic oversight, performance evaluation, and risk management, making it essential for members to possess diverse expertise and qualifications.

Furthermore, committees formed under the board are integral to the governance process. They focus on specific functions such as audit, compensation, and governance, allowing for detailed oversight and accountability. Governance policies and procedures, including a code of conduct and a conflict of interest policy, also form a crucial part of the charter, ensuring ethical standards are maintained.

Clear definition of board structure, roles, and responsibilities.
Detailed descriptions of committee functions and duties.
Policies governing ethical behavior and conflicts of interest.
Procedures for reporting and compliance monitoring.

Drafting your corporate governance charter

Drafting a corporate governance charter is a structured process that involves several key steps. Firstly, it is crucial to establish clear objectives and the vision of the charter, aligning it with the organization's mission and values. This foundational step sets the tone for the rest of the document and serves as a guiding principle.

Next, defining board composition is essential; specifying criteria for member selection ensures that the board is composed of individuals with varied skills and experiences. Outlining committee structures and their functions provides clarity on organizational oversight, while detailing meeting protocols and decision-making processes fosters efficiency in governance.

Additionally, compliance and reporting requirements should be specified to enhance accountability. Incorporating these elements into the drafting process is vital for an effective charter that promotes transparency and ethical decision-making.

Establish clear objectives and vision aligned with organizational values.
Define board composition and member selection criteria.
Outline committee structures and their specific functions.
Detail meeting protocols and established decision-making processes.
Specify compliance and reporting requirements for oversight.

Utilizing clear and concise language enhances clarity, while involving stakeholder input can help ensure that the charter meets the needs of all parties involved. Engaging in conversations with key stakeholders can reveal insights that shape a more practical document.

Common challenges and solutions in corporate governance charter management

Managing a corporate governance charter comes with its fair share of challenges. Organizations often face resistance to change, particularly when the charter introduces new governance practices or modifies existing structures. Overcoming this resistance requires effective communication strategies to convey the benefits of the updated charter and encourage buy-in from all stakeholders.

Another significant challenge is ensuring continuous compliance with legal and regulatory requirements. Governance standards can evolve rapidly, and organizations must be adaptable, reviewing their charters regularly to align with new laws and best practices. Implementing a policy for routine updates and stakeholder engagement can mitigate this challenge.

Finally, adapting the charter to meet evolving business needs is crucial. Organizations should view the governance charter as a living document, one that requires flexibility and responsiveness to market changes.

Address resistance to change through effective communication and engagement.
Establish a routine for reviewing and updating the charter to ensure compliance.
Maintain flexibility in the charter to adapt to evolving business needs.
Encourage ongoing stakeholder involvement in governance processes.

A corporate governance charter is a formal document that outlines the responsibilities, practices, and policies governing the relationship between a company's management, its board of directors, and its stakeholders. It serves as a framework for effective governance and decision-making within the organization.
Typically, publicly traded companies are required to file a corporate governance charter as part of their compliance with regulatory requirements. However, privately held companies may also adopt similar charters for internal governance purposes.
To fill out a corporate governance charter, companies should outline their governance structure, including the roles and responsibilities of the board of directors, committees, and management. They should include details on meeting protocols, decision-making processes, and governance policies. It's essential to ensure that the charter reflects the company's specific operational and strategic needs.
The purpose of a corporate governance charter is to establish clear guidelines and standards for how a company is governed. It aims to promote transparency, accountability, and ethical behavior within the organization, thereby enhancing stakeholder confidence and ensuring compliance with relevant laws and regulations.
A corporate governance charter should include information on the company's governance structure, the roles and responsibilities of the board and its committees, conflict of interest policies, procedures for board evaluations, and guidelines for ethical conduct. It may also outline how the company ensures compliance with applicable laws and regulations.
